Dealers tell folks that delays are due to a chip shortage because they know people are aware of a chip shortage and will understand that. That gets the dealer off the hook from talking to people when they don't have a real answer.

The various chip shortages are not particularly applicable to the 2021 MME's as the chips needed were ordered far in advance for the 50,000 car allocation. Delivery of those chips and other parts may be slower than expected, but there's no shortage for the MME. Second, chips are not stand-alone components. They're part of another component and aren't just that easy to drop in place on an electric car after it's assembled.

I suspect that the latest 2+ month shipping delay estimates are an overly conservative guess as to delivery date, just as the last round was.

I just learned of a fresh delay. Here is my purchase experience time-line:

2/9/21: order accepted by dealer, $500 charged to credit card.

4/15/21: email from Ford estimating production time as week of 6/7/21

6/10/21: email from Ford that car was built, estimating delivery to dealer in range 7/16/21 - 7/22/21

6/15/21: email from Ford that car is shipped, repeating delivery time estimate.

6/25/21: learned from https://palsapp.com/ that the car was delivered from Kansas City to the Muncie Ramp on that date. There have been no subsequent changes on palsapp.

7/12/21: learned, via incessant checking at Ford.com, that the new delivery estimate is 8/16/21 - 8/22/21.

From the various inside information I have heard from Ford, I am not aware of any significant impact of chip shortages on the Mach E production line. In fact, Ford recently announced they are getting the chip shortage resolved on the F-150 and Super Duty truck lines.

I suspect you are more likely running into delays resulting from the production of GTs for folks who have been long-term reservation holders. Remember that there are lots of folks awaiting GTs who placed reservations as far back as 2019. 2021 orders that are not associated with 2019-2020 reservations may slip as GT production kicks into high gear.
